The Clean-Label Revolution: Moving Beyond MSG

For decades, monosodium glutamate (MSG) was the secret weapon for achieving umami, the savory fifth taste, in everything from restaurant kitchens to packaged foods. However, the modern consumer's growing demand for clean-label, natural ingredients has created a paradigm shift. Enter mushroom-based seasonings, led by innovators like DASHANHE Group. These seasonings are crafted from naturally dried and ground mushrooms, which are inherently rich in glutamates—the same compounds that give MSG its punch. The result is a powerful, savory flavor that comes directly from a whole food source, allowing product labels to feature recognizable ingredients like "shiitake mushroom powder" instead of chemical-sounding additives. A Symphony of Flavor: Complexity Where It Matters

The revolution is not just about removing an ingredient; it's about adding unparalleled depth and complexity. Unlike the one-dimensional taste profile of MSG, mushroom-based seasonings from DASHANHE offer a nuanced symphony of flavors. A blend utilizing shiitake mushrooms contributes a robust, earthy base, while porcini adds a rich, almost nutty character. This natural complexity means that a dash of DASHANHE's umami seasoning can enhance the inherent savoriness of meats, deepen the flavor of vegetarian and plant-based dishes, and add a new layer of richness to soups, sauces, and marinades.
